With a playoff win on the line, Xavier rose to the challenge on Thursday. They put the hurt on the West Bend East Suns with a sharp 3-0 victory. The win continues a trend for the Hawks in their matchups with the Suns: they've now won five in a row.

Xavier was especially dominant in the third set. The match finished with set scores of 25-16, 25-21, 25-12.

Rose Kendall paced Xavier's offense, picking up 12 kills. Kendall got some help from Sydney Neilitz and her 28 assists. Lily Renz controlled things from the service line, finishing with three aces.

When it comes to explaining why West Bend East lost, don't look at Sami Weber. Despite the final result, she had ten digs and two assists. Weber has been hot recently, having posted ten or more digs the last four times she's played.

Xavier's victory bumped their record up to 28-10. As for West Bend East, they moved to 16-23 with that loss, which also ended their three-match winning streak.

Xavier has already played their next matchup, a 3-1 win against Kewaskum on the 25th. West Bend East does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
